Ruth Fielding on the St. Lawrence or The Queer Old Man of the Thousand Islands
Book Description
1922. Illustrated. Ruth Fielding is one of the early series for young girls written by the pen name of Alice B. Emerson. Ruth Fielding was an orphan and came to live with her miserly uncle. Her adventures and travels will hold the interest of every reader.
